What Are Ghana Proxy Servers?
A Ghana proxy server routes your internet traffic through an IP address located in Ghana. Residential Ghanaian proxies use real IP addresses assigned by Ghanaian ISPs such as MTN Ghana, Vodafone Ghana, AirtelTigo, and Busy Internet, making your requests appear as genuine Ghanaian household or mobile connections. This is essential for accessing Ghana-specific content, collecting data from local e-commerce platforms like Jumia Ghana and Tonaton, and verifying how websites and digital services appear to Ghanaian users. As one of West Africa's most stable and digitally progressive economies, Ghanaian proxies offer a reliable gateway for businesses exploring West African markets.

What Ghanaian ISPs are in the proxy pool?
Our Ghana proxy pool includes IPs from major Ghanaian providers including MTN Ghana, Vodafone Ghana, AirtelTigo, Busy Internet, and Surfline. Ghana's mobile-first internet landscape means most IPs are mobile, primarily from MTN and Vodafone, reflecting how the majority of Ghanaians access the internet.
How fast are Ghana proxy connections?
ProxyHat's Ghana proxy network delivers average latency under 210ms for European connections. Ghana benefits from submarine cable infrastructure including MainOne, SAT-3, and GLO-1 landing in Accra. MTN and Vodafone continue to expand 4G coverage across major cities, providing improving speeds for both residential and mobile proxy connections.
